The first name Federico has its origins in the Germanic name "Frithuric," which is composed of the elements "frithu," meaning peace, and "ric," meaning ruler or power. This name first appeared in the early medieval period and was popularized in various regions of Europe, particularly in Italy and Spain, where it became associated with nobility and leadership. The meaning of Federico reflects qualities of a peaceful ruler, suggesting a person who embodies both strength and harmony. Variations of the name can be found across different cultures, including "Federico" in Italian and Spanish, "Friedrich" in German, and "Frederick" in English. Each variation maintains a connection to the original meaning, though pronunciation and spelling may differ. Historically, notable figures bearing the name include Federico II, the Holy Roman Emperor, and various Italian Renaissance artists and leaders, further cementing its association with power and creativity.
The last name Martinelli has Italian origins, primarily associated with the regions of Tuscany and Emilia-Romagna. It is derived from the given name "Martino," which is the Italian form of "Martin," itself rooted in the Latin name "Martinus," meaning "of Mars" or "warlike." Historically, surnames like Martinelli were often adopted to denote lineage, indicating "son of Martin" or "descendant of Martin," and were commonly associated with individuals who may have held occupations related to agriculture or craftsmanship, reflecting the agrarian society of medieval Italy. Variations of the surname can be found across different cultures, including "Martini" in Italy and "Martinez" in Spanish-speaking countries, showcasing differences in spelling and pronunciation that reflect regional linguistic characteristics. The name Martinelli is also linked to various notable figures in Italian history, further enriching its cultural significance.
